#119313 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#119313 is composed of 6.7% red, 57.6% green and 7.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 87.1%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 120.9 degrees, a saturation of 79.3% and a lightness of 32.2%. #119313 color hex could be obtained by blending #22ff26 with #002700. Closest websafe color is: #009900.

Shades and Tints of #119313
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010601 is the darkest color, while #f4fef4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#119313
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#505450 is the less saturated color, while #04a007 is the most saturated one.
